nonsteroidal Anti-Inflammatory Drugs (NSAIDs)‍ are⁢ among the most commonly prescribed medications for managing ⁢pain and inflammation associated with musculoskeletal conditions. Medications‌ such ⁢as ibuprofen and naproxen ‌ work by inhibiting enzymes that⁤ contribute to inflammation, providing relief for a range of issues ⁤from arthritis to acute injuries. Their accessibility and effectiveness ⁣make them a go-to option for many healthcare ‍providers. Though, it’s crucial to remain aware of the ​risks that accompany their use, particularly for ‌individuals ​requiring ​long-term treatment.

Long-term‍ NSAID use can lead to significant side effects,which⁢ include:

  • gastrointestinal ​bleeding: Prolonged use may damage the stomach lining,increasing the risk of ulcers and bleeding.
  • Kidney ⁤issues: ⁤NSAIDs can affect‍ kidney function, especially in those with preexisting conditions.
  • Cardiovascular risks: Some studies suggest a potential increase⁣ in heart attack or stroke risk‌ with long-term NSAID use.

Thus, while ​NSAIDs are effective for short-term‍ pain‍ relief, careful consideration and monitoring are essential for those needing chronic​ management of musculoskeletal pain. Always consult a healthcare professional to weigh the benefits against potential risks before starting or continuing NSAID therapy.

Acetaminophen, commonly known by its ‍brand name Tylenol, is a go-to option for individuals grappling with mild to moderate musculoskeletal pain. Its efficacy lies in its ability to alleviate discomfort without the gastrointestinal ⁣side effects‍ frequently ‍enough associated⁤ with nonsteroidal ‌anti-inflammatory drugs (NSAIDs). This makes it particularly‌ appealing for those who may have pre-existing conditions that could be exacerbated by NSAID use. Acetaminophen works by blocking ‌pain signals ‌in the brain, providing a straightforward ‍solution for those seeking relief from everyday⁣ aches and pains.

However,⁣ while acetaminophen‍ is generally⁢ considered safe when used as directed, it is crucial to adhere strictly‍ to recommended dosages. Exceeding these limits can result in severe liver ⁢damage, a risk that underscores the‍ importance⁤ of mindful consumption.To help users navigate this medication safely, here’s a ​rapid ​reference table outlining​ key ‍dosage guidelines:

dosage Form Recommended⁣ Dose Maximum Daily Limit
Adult Tablets (500 mg) 1-2 tablets​ every 4-6 hours 8‍ tablets (4000 mg)
Liquid‍ Suspension (160 mg/5 mL) 10-15 mL​ every 4-6 ​hours 60 mL (4800 mg)

Muscle relaxants are a common choice for individuals grappling with⁤ conditions characterized ⁢by involuntary ​muscle contractions⁢ or spasms. These ‌medications work‌ by acting on the central nervous system to reduce muscle tightness and⁢ discomfort, ultimately enhancing mobility⁣ and ‍overall quality‍ of life. Though, it’s crucial to be aware of the potential‌ side effects associated⁢ with​ their ⁢use.‌ Common‌ issues include:

  • Drowsiness: This can considerably affect daily ​tasks,including driving and ⁤operating machinery.
  • dizziness: Users may experience balance ​issues,⁤ increasing the risk ⁤of falls.
  • Dependence: Prolonged use ‍can ⁤lead to physical dependence, making‍ it essential to follow‍ a doctor’s guidance.

To ensure the ‌safe ⁣and effective⁤ use of‍ muscle relaxants, careful monitoring is ‌necessary. Regular consultations with a‍ healthcare provider can help tailor the dosage to the individual’s needs, minimizing ⁣the risk of adverse effects.‍ Adjustments​ may be required based on factors such as age, overall ‌health, and the presence of other medications. Below⁣ is a‍ simple ⁢overview of ⁤common muscle relaxants and their considerations:

Medication Common uses Key​ Considerations
carisoprodol Muscle​ spasms Potential for ​dependence
Cyclobenzaprine Acute muscle ⁤pain May cause drowsiness
Metaxalone Muscle relaxant Less sedative effects
Baclofen Spasticity Withdrawal​ symptoms‍ possible

Corticosteroids are a powerful class of medications that play a pivotal ⁤role in⁢ managing inflammation associated with⁤ various musculoskeletal disorders. their ability to provide rapid⁢ relief⁢ from pain⁣ and swelling makes them ⁤a go-to option for many healthcare providers. When administered, corticosteroids work by mimicking the effects of hormones ⁢produced by‍ the adrenal glands, effectively suppressing the‌ immune response and reducing inflammation.This can lead to significant improvements in mobility and quality of life‍ for patients⁢ suffering from conditions like arthritis,tendinitis,and other⁤ inflammatory disorders.

However, ⁢the benefits⁣ of‍ corticosteroids come with notable risks, particularly when used over extended periods. Long-term use can lead to bone density loss, increasing the risk of fractures and osteoporosis. Additionally,patients‌ may experience an increased susceptibility to ⁣infections,as corticosteroids ‌can dampen the body’s immune​ response. To⁢ mitigate these risks, it is essential⁤ for healthcare ⁤providers to adopt​ a cautious⁤ approach, carefully ⁤balancing treatment duration and dosage. Regular⁢ monitoring and‌ consideration ⁣of alternative therapies can⁣ help ensure that ⁢patients receive effective‍ pain ⁤relief while⁤ minimizing potential adverse ⁣effects.

Scoliosis, a condition characterized by an ⁤abnormal curvature of⁣ the⁣ spine, can originate from various underlying causes. Understanding these causes is ⁣crucial for⁢ effective management and treatment. Idiopathic scoliosis, which accounts for the‌ majority of‌ cases, typically arises during‍ adolescence without a known cause. This type is frequently enough characterized by a progressive curvature that can worsen as the child grows. Conversely, congenital scoliosis develops due to ⁣malformations ⁢of the spine present at⁣ birth. this type can vary substantially in‍ severity, depending⁤ on the specific vertebral anomalies. Lastly, neuromuscular scoliosis is associated with conditions that affect the nerves and muscles, such as cerebral‍ palsy or muscular dystrophy. In these cases, the spineS curvature results from imbalances in muscle strength and control, leading to a more complex treatment ‌approach.

Recognizing‌ the distinctions between these types of scoliosis is essential for tailoring treatment strategies. As an example, idiopathic scoliosis often requires observation, bracing, or surgical intervention based on the degree of curvature and the patient’s growth potential.In contrast, congenital scoliosis may necessitate‍ early surgical ‌intervention to correct or stabilize the spine and ​prevent further complications. Neuromuscular scoliosis management typically involves a multidisciplinary approach, including physical therapy, orthopedic care, and possibly surgery, to address the underlying ‍neuromuscular⁢ issues. By⁣ categorizing the type of scoliosis, healthcare providers can develop personalized care plans that address the unique challenges and needs ⁤of ​each ⁢patient.

What Causes ⁤Joint pain?

Several factors can contribute‌ to joint pain. ‍ Let’s ‍explore some of the most⁤ common culprits:

Osteoarthritis: This is the most common form of arthritis, caused by the breakdown ​of cartilage, the​ protective ⁢cushion between bones. This breakdown leads to ⁤bone rubbing against bone, causing pain,‌ stiffness, and ⁢reduced range of motion. Risk⁣ factors include age, genetics, obesity, and previous joint injuries.

Rheumatoid​ Arthritis: This⁣ is an ‍autoimmune disease where the body’s immune system mistakenly⁢ attacks the ⁣lining of the joints. This causes inflammation, pain, swelling, and⁣ stiffness. Rheumatoid arthritis can ⁤affect multiple joints⁣ together and can lead to joint damage⁤ over time.

⁢ Gout: This type of arthritis is caused by a buildup of uric acid crystals in the joints, frequently enough affecting the big toe. it​ causes sudden, severe pain,⁤ redness, ⁤and swelling. Dietary factors, genetics, and certain ⁣medical conditions can contribute to gout.

Bursitis: Bursae are small, fluid-filled sacs that cushion the joints. Bursitis occurs when these sacs become inflamed, often due to repetitive motions⁣ or overuse. Common areas affected include the shoulder,elbow,hip,and knee.

Tendinitis: Tendons are the tough cords that ‍connect muscles to bones.Tendinitis is the inflammation of a tendon, frequently enough‍ caused by overuse or repetitive strain. Common areas affected ⁣include the shoulder, elbow, ‌wrist, ⁣and Achilles tendon.

Injuries: Sprains, strains, dislocations, and fractures can all cause joint ‌pain. These injuries can ⁤result‌ from falls, sports activities,⁣ or other ​accidents.

Understanding Your Joints

Your joints are where two or more bones meet. they are complex structures involving cartilage (a cushion ​between⁢ bones), ligaments (connecting bones to bones), tendons (connecting muscles to bones), and synovial fluid (a lubricating‌ liquid). Problems ‌can arise in any of these components, leading to pain, stiffness, and reduced function.

Recognizing the ​Red flags: When to Seek Immediate ⁤Medical Attention

Certain joint symptoms ​signal a possibly serious issue requiring immediate medical attention. Don’t delay seeking help if you experience:

Sudden, severe joint pain: ‍ Especially after ‌an injury.
Joint deformity: ​ A joint that looks out of place or misshapen.
Inability to bear weight: being unable to put weight on the affected joint.
Intense swelling and redness: ⁣Accompanied by warmth around the joint.
Fever and chills: Combined with joint pain,this could indicate⁤ an infection.
Locking or catching of the joint: Preventing normal ‍movement.
Numbness or tingling: In the⁤ area ‍around the joint.

What Causes Gout?

Gout occurs when excess ‌uric acid builds⁤ up⁢ in your body. Uric acid is a waste⁢ product​ created when your body breaks down purines, which⁤ are found naturally in your body and in‍ certain‍ foods. Normally,⁣ uric acid dissolves in your blood and is filtered out by your kidneys. However, sometimes your⁤ body produces too much⁣ uric acid or your kidneys don’t​ filter enough out. This leads to a buildup of uric ‍acid crystals in your⁢ joints, ‌triggering inflammation‍ and‌ pain – the hallmark ​of ‍a gout attack.

Recognizing the Symptoms of Gout

Gout attacks often come on suddenly, frequently at night. ‍ Common symptoms include:

Intense joint pain: This usually affects the big toe, ⁢but can occur ⁤in other joints like the ankles,‍ knees, elbows, wrists, and fingers.
Swelling: ‌The affected joint will become swollen, red, and hot to the touch.
Tenderness: Even the⁣ slightest touch to the‌ joint can cause extreme pain.
Limited range of motion: You may find it difficult ‍to move the affected joint.
Lingering ​discomfort: Even after the ⁣most ‍intense pain subsides, some discomfort may linger for days or weeks.

Preventing Gout: Taking Control of Your Health

While ‌some risk factors for gout, like genetics⁢ and age, are beyond your control, many lifestyle changes can significantly reduce your risk ‍of developing this painful condition or experiencing⁣ future attacks.

Dietary Changes: Watch What You‍ Eat

Limit purine-rich foods: ‍Reduce your intake of red meat, organ meats (like liver and kidneys), seafood (especially shellfish and anchovies), and sugary drinks.
Choose low-fat dairy products: ⁣Studies suggest that low-fat dairy ⁢products may help lower uric acid levels.
Hydrate, hydrate, hydrate: Drinking plenty of water helps flush uric ⁤acid out of your system. Aim for 8 glasses a day.
Moderate alcohol consumption: Alcohol can interfere with uric acid⁤ removal. Limit ‍your intake, especially beer.
Focus on fruits and vegetables: These are generally low in purines and‌ provide ⁢essential vitamins and minerals. Cherries, in particular, have shown ⁣some promise in reducing gout attacks.

Lifestyle Modifications: Making Healthy Choices

Maintain a healthy weight: Being overweight or obese increases your risk of gout. Losing even a small amount of ​weight can make a difference.
Exercise regularly: Regular physical activity helps maintain a⁤ healthy weight and improves overall health. Choose low-impact exercises like walking, swimming, or cycling.
Manage underlying conditions: Conditions like high blood pressure, diabetes, and ⁢kidney disease can increase your risk of gout. Work with your doctor to manage these ⁢conditions effectively.
Medication management: Certain medications, like diuretics ⁢(water pills), can increase uric acid levels. Talk to your‍ doctor​ about any potential medication interactions.

Understanding Your Medications

Uric acid-lowering medications: Your doctor may prescribe medications to lower uric acid levels if you experience frequent gout attacks.
Anti-inflammatory medications: These medications ‍can help⁣ reduce⁤ pain ​and inflammation during a gout attack.

Acetaminophen, often recognized by its brand name Tylenol, stands out as a popular choice for those dealing with mild to moderate pain, especially in musculoskeletal conditions. Its effectiveness lies in its ability to relieve discomfort without ‍the anti-inflammatory properties associated with nonsteroidal anti-inflammatory drugs (NSAIDs). This⁣ makes it an appealing option for individuals who may be sensitive to the gastrointestinal side effects of NSAIDs or those who have certain health conditions that contraindicate their use. However, while acetaminophen is generally‍ regarded as safe when taken according to guidelines, users must remain vigilant about dosage limits to avoid potential risks.

Excessive intake of acetaminophen can lead to severe liver damage, a risk that underscores the necessity of adhering⁢ to recommended dosages. The maximum daily limit for most ⁣adults is typically set at 4,000 milligrams, but for those ⁢with liver conditions or chronic alcohol use, lower limits may be advisable. To help ensure safe usage, ⁣consider the following key points:

  • Monitor Dosage: Always check labels of ⁣combination medications that may contain acetaminophen.
  • Consult Healthcare Providers: Discuss your pain management plan with a doctor, especially if you have pre-existing health issues.
  • Avoid Alcohol: Limit alcohol consumption while using acetaminophen to reduce the risk of liver damage.

Corticosteroids, often hailed as a⁤ cornerstone in the management of inflammatory musculoskeletal conditions, wield remarkable power in alleviating pain and swelling. These synthetic drugs mimic the effects of hormones produced by the adrenal glands, effectively dampening the immune response that contributes to inflammation. When prescribed for conditions like arthritis and tendonitis, corticosteroids​ can lead to rapid‌ improvements, allowing patients ⁤to regain mobility and engage in​ daily activities with less discomfort. However, the benefits come with a caveat: the potential for significant side effects, especially with long-term use.

It’s crucial for both patients and healthcare providers to weigh the‌ pros and ‌cons of corticosteroid therapy. While the short-term relief can be life-changing, the risks associated with prolonged use can be daunting. Consider the following potential side effects:

  • Weight Gain: Corticosteroids can increase appetite and alter metabolism, leading to unwanted weight gain.
  • Osteoporosis: Long-term use may weaken ⁤bones, increasing the risk of fractures.
  • Increased Infection Risk: ‌These medications can suppress the immune system, making individuals more vulnerable to infections.

Given these considerations, a thoughtful approach to corticosteroid ⁢use is ‌essential in treatment plans,‍ ensuring that the benefits of pain⁣ relief are balanced against‍ the potential for adverse effects.

Tendons are the strong cords that‌ connect ⁣your muscles to your ​bones, ⁤allowing you to move smoothly and powerfully. When these tendons become irritated or inflamed, it’s called tendinitis. This common condition can ‍cause pain, ⁢stiffness, and weakness, making everyday⁢ activities difficult.

Understanding tendinitis and taking steps to prevent it can help you maintain a healthy and active lifestyle.

What Causes Tendinitis?

Tendinitis ⁢often develops gradually due to overuse or repetitive motions. Imagine a rope being pulled back and forth over a rough edge – eventually, it will fray. Tendons can experience similar wear and ⁤tear, leading to inflammation.

Common causes of tendinitis include:

Repetitive movements: Jobs or hobbies that involve the same motions repeatedly, like typing,⁣ playing tennis, or painting,‍ can strain tendons.
Overuse: Suddenly increasing the intensity or duration of physical activity without proper conditioning can‌ overload tendons.
Poor posture: Holding your body in awkward positions for extended periods can put stress on tendons.
Age: As we age, our‍ tendons naturally lose some elasticity, making them more susceptible ‌to injury.
